Biography
Cheryl Mazzariello Hooker is a lifelong resident of Rutland. She graduated from Mount Saint Joseph Academy and Castleton State College. She and her husband George have four children (Sam, Molly, Emily and T.J) and six grandchildren.
Hooker is a retired middle school and high schoolteacher and spends her time with family and friends and volunteers at the Rutland Free Library, The Rutland Community Cupboard, Rutland Dismas House and her church.
Political career
From 1999 to 2002, Hooker served on the Rutland City Board of Aldermen. She also served in the

(1990-1991, 1993-1995, 2000, 2001-2003) and Vermont Senate (1997-1999). In 2018, she was again elected to the Vermont Senate, and she was reelected in 2020.
Hooker serves as the Clerk of the Senate Committee on Economic Development, Housing, and General Affairs and as the Clerk of the Senate Committee on Institutions.
She is a member of the Senate Sexual Harassment Panel.
Hooker is one of three state senators serving on the Judicial Nominating Board.
